Dayu Electronics: Wireless Ultrasonic Water Level Meter is a Non-Contact Level Measurement Instrument
Wireless Ultrasonic Water Level Meter is a non-contact, cost-effective, and easy-to-install and maintain level measurement instrument. It can meet the water level measurement requirements of most municipal pipe network observation wells without contacting the medium.
The wireless ultrasonic water level meter uses the ultrasonic echo ranging principle and precise time-of-flight measurement technology to detect the distance between the sensor and the target object. It employs a small-angle, small blind zone ultrasonic sensor, offering advantages such as accurate measurement, non-contact operation, waterproofing, corrosion resistance, and low cost.

This product adopts the traditional ultrasonic level meter principle: the ultrasonic transducer (probe) emits high-frequency pulse sound waves that are reflected off the surface of the material being measured, and the reflected echo is received by the transducer and converted into an electrical signal.
The propagation time of the sound wave is proportional to the distance from the sound wave emission to the object surface. The relationship between the sound wave transmission distance S, the speed of sound C, and the sound transmission time T can be expressed by the formula: S=C×T/2. During the emission of the sound pulse, mechanical inertia occupies transmission time, so a small area near the ultrasonic transducer cannot receive sound waves; this area is called the blind zone. The size of the blind zone is related to the ultrasonic range.
